Research on the Analysis of Obstacle Factors in Medium - and Low - Yield Farmland and Its Improvement Countermeasures

ABSTRACT
This paper systematically analyzes the main obstacle factors affecting the productivity of medium - and low - yield farmland in China, aiming at the current situation of such farmland. Through literature research and field investigations, it explores the impacts of natural factors such as poor soil fertility, poor drainage, salinization, acidification, and shallow soil layers, as well as human - induced factors such as improper tillage management and unreasonable fertilization on farmland productivity. The study finds that the obstacle factors in medium - and low - yield farmland are complex and regionally different, and targeted improvement measures are required. Based on the analysis results, this paper puts forward comprehensive improvement countermeasures such as soil improvement, construction of water conservancy facilities, scientific fertilization, and rational crop rotation, in order to provide a theoretical basis and practical guidance for improving the productivity of medium - and low - yield farmland and ensuring food security.
